It really depends on what you are looking for in your basshead custom IEM.  If you are looking for overall bass rumble with good speed and detail across the board, then yes.  There are others such as the Infinity X3 that offers a more spacious presentation, but it is lacking that bass rumble (everything at the price point is).  I would recommend a 75 ohm impedance adapter if you want a smoother sound, which is my preference, but I can listen without if I don't listen to certain other custom IEMs beforehand!
 
I will say the shell is the nicest I have ever seen and I do like them quite a bit!
